FP Canada announced March 23 its 2020 President’s List which recognizes candidates who received the top marks on last November’s Certified Financial Planner (CFP) Exams.  

In first place is Rory Drennen of Ottawa who works with RBC. In second place is Jarrett Holmes of Winnipeg (Ironshield Financial Planning Inc.) and in third place, Kristopher Kibler of Calgary (Flight Plan Financial Corp.

FP Canada also recognized the top scoring candidate for the November sitting of the Qualified Associate Financial Planner exam. The first recipient of the QAFP Exam Award of Merit is Nicole Robyn, from Hamilton, ON (RBC). 

"Congratulations to the successful candidates on the 2020 exams. These candidates demonstrated exceptional dedication and focus to score top marks, despite the challenges posed by the pandemic," stated Cary List, President and CEO of FP Canada. 

In response to the pandemic, FP Canada offered candidates the option of taking the exams through online proctoring in November. FP Canada will continue to offer the CFP Exam and the QAFP Exam through online proctoring throughout 2021. The next two certification exams will be held in May and October, 2021.
